Output 31fb68909abc266428a14e9a56ab3f296209a369f917ef22ea0b04beecfb33a4:50

value
330625317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c164a96f9fa389268340e966dfc55c88e1202df OP_EQUAL
address
38dKyxHzUoP2DkKK2Q256YMGMmKRtHWqut
transaction
31fb68909abc266428a14e9a56ab3f296209a369f917ef22ea0b04beecfb33a4
spent
true